>Thanks for the answer Katy. I hoped to hear that. That means all panels 
>could be hooked up using a different keyboard but will function as one 
>input. This could, will simplify things a great deal.
>
>Ken

Only thing to be aware of is: If you have a CTRL/ALT/SHIFT pressed on one 
keyboard, it affects all others... i.e. If you have CTRL+A pressed on one, 
and C on another, the PC will "see" CTRL+A and CTRL+C. As long as you are 
not pressing two buttons simultaneously it should not be a problem though.

Once upon a time I thought about using 3 USB keyboards, one standard, one 
with SHIFT hardwired, and the third with CTRL hardwired.... sadly it didn't 
work like that :(
